Today marks the One year anniversary that my lovely Dad passed away, after his brief but heroic battle with Pancreatic Cancer, aged just 55.

Since his death I have been determined to give something back...to raise awareness for this horrific disease.
26 people are newly diagnosed with this disease everyday - symptoms including stomach pains, nausea, fatigue, back pain and loss of appetite are not generally a major cause for concern, however these symptoms are all signs of Pancreatic Cancer and an early diagnosis is vital to increase chances of survival.

My Dad's cancer was already at Stage 4 when detected, which meant it was untreatable and he lasted only 9 weeks from diagnosis to his death. He spent his last few weeks at a Sue Ryder Hospice not far from his home where he received the most incredible treatment and care - something I'll be forever thankful for 💕
